{"product_id":"readerful-independent-library-oxford-r-13","title":"Readerful Independent Library Oxford R","description":"When Melody''s dad suddenly makes them move house to live with his girlfriend, she''s not happy. Worst of all, Melody now has a stepbrother. She starts a new school and makes friends, but auditions for the school play are coming up and Melody is determined to try to get a part. Will this put her at odds with her new friends?This book is from Readerful''s Independent Library. It is for children aged 9 to 10 to read without support.
